tutorials.de Buch-Aktion 05/2012
ERLEDIGT
NEIN
ANTWORTEN
3
ZUGRIFFE
303
EMPFEHLEN
  • An Twitter übertragen
  • An Facebook übertragen
AUF DIESES THEMA
ANTWORTEN
  1. #1
    Avatar von Blackhawk50000
    Blackhawk50000 Blackhawk50000 ist offline Mitglied Brokat
    Registriert seit
    Oct 2007
    Ort
    Erding As, Bayern, Germany, Germany
    Beiträge
    328
    Hallo, jetzt wird es etwas kompliziert, und ich würde nur gerne wissen, ob meine Gedankengänge richtig sind. und wenn sie das sind, habe ich dann doch noch ne frage =)


    Also ich habe eine DataTable und da stehen Personen drin.

    Jede Person hat eine anzahl von Spalten. wenn man nun die Spalten als Keys und die dazugehörigen werte der person als Values bezeichnet, , dann ist EINE spalte einer Person ein KeyValuePair.

    eine ganze Zeile ist dann eine Liste von KeyValuePairs also ein Dictionary<string, object>

    Mehrere Personen sind eine Liste diese Liste also quasi ein List<Dictionary<string, object>>

    und wenn ich jetzt noch mehrere Tabellen habe denen ich namen geben kann dann ist das ja quasi folgende Struktur:

    Code csharp:
    1
    2
    
    //.5.........1......4.................2.....3
    Dictionary<string, List<Dictionary<string, object>>>

    1 = Name der Tabelle
    2 = Name der Spalte
    3 = Wert der Spalte

    4(2&3) = eine komplette Zeile

    5 = Liste der Tabelle mit Tabellen-namen als Key



    Bin ich soweit richtig?
     

  2. #2
    tequila slammer tequila slammer ist offline Mitglied Gold
    Registriert seit
    Aug 2006
    Beiträge
    204
    Also eine DataTable ist ein Tabelle. Für mich bedeutete das, dass pro Personendatensatz eine Zeile in der Tabelle stehen.
     

  3. #3
    Avatar von Blackhawk50000
    Blackhawk50000 Blackhawk50000 ist offline Mitglied Brokat
    Registriert seit
    Oct 2007
    Ort
    Erding As, Bayern, Germany, Germany
    Beiträge
    328
    das hat mir nicht grade weitergeholfen

    silverlight kann keine DataTable und ich brauche irgendein object was ich via c# webservice an einen silverlight client schicken kann. das sollte so ähnlich wie eine DataTable sein
     

  4. #4
    Avatar von Spyke
    Spyke Spyke ist offline Capoeirista
    Registriert seit
    Oct 2002
    Beiträge
    931
    Direkt ein eigenes C# Objektmodell für dein Problem anlegen?
    Kenne mich mit Silverlight nicht aus, aber müsste das nicht gehen wenn dann beide die gleiche DLL referenzieren in dem das Objektmodell drin ist ? ? ?

    Oder ganz blöd dem Silverlight ein CSV Datei ähnlichen Stringaufbau schicken.
    Den du da wieder auseinander pflücken kannst.
     
    www.iv-interactive.de - Projektewebsite
    WikiParser - aktuelles Projekt

Ähnliche Themen

  1. DataTable
    Von coolfire im Forum .NET Archiv
    Antworten: 6
    Letzter Beitrag: 24.11.10, 17:15
  2. [JSF] Datatable in Datatable
    Von Bexx im Forum Enterprise Java (JEE, J2EE, Spring & Co.)
    Antworten: 1
    Letzter Beitrag: 02.05.10, 12:41
  3. JSF und dataTable
    Von naeko im Forum Java
    Antworten: 0
    Letzter Beitrag: 13.04.07, 15:21
  4. DataTable zu anderer DataTable hinzufügen
    Von broetchen im Forum .NET Datenverwaltung
    Antworten: 4
    Letzter Beitrag: 12.09.05, 15:00
  5. DataTable
    Von LordDeath im Forum .NET Archiv
    Antworten: 0
    Letzter Beitrag: 21.10.04, 12:43